Comparative study of laparoscopic versus open repair of inguinal herniA
Dr. Narendra Teja, Dr. Dheeraj Talagadadeevi
Abstract :
Hernia is common problem faced in surgeon daily practice. Laparoscopy role in hernia is evolving day by day. although there are studies worldwide
compå the open and laparoscopic repair of inguinal hernia, very few studies have been reported from developing countries like India. A
prospective study done compå the same with sample size of 60. Our study showed laparoscopic repair has Less incidence of SSI, Early return to
work,less postoperative pain, compared to open repair. inspite of high operative time, cost, single case of recurrence this study laparoscopic repair
is as good as open repair and a alternative to open repair.
